#ifndef StmHalSpi_h
#define StmHalSpi_h

// *****************************************************************************
// ***   Includes   ************************************************************
// *****************************************************************************
#include "DevCfg.h"
#include "ISpi.h"

// *****************************************************************************
// ***   This driver can be compiled only if UART configured in CubeMX   *******
// *****************************************************************************
#ifndef HAL_SPI_MODULE_ENABLED
  typedef uint32_t SPI_HandleTypeDef; // Dummy SPI handle for header compilation
#endif

// *****************************************************************************
// ***   STM32 HAL ISPI  Driver Class   ****************************************
// *****************************************************************************
class StHalSpi : public ISpi
{
  public:
    // *************************************************************************
    // ***   Public: Constructor   *********************************************
    // *************************************************************************
    explicit StHalSpi(SPI_HandleTypeDef& hspi_ref) : hspi(hspi_ref) {};

    // *************************************************************************
    // ***   Public: Destructor   **********************************************
    // *************************************************************************
    ~StHalSpi() {};

    // *************************************************************************
    // ***   Public: Init   ****************************************************
    // *************************************************************************
    virtual Result Init() {return Result::RESULT_OK;}

    // *************************************************************************
    // ***   Public: DeInit   **************************************************
    // *************************************************************************
    virtual Result DeInit() {return Result::ERR_NOT_IMPLEMENTED;}

    // *************************************************************************
    // ***   Public: Transfer   ************************************************
    // *************************************************************************
    virtual Result Transfer(uint8_t* rx_buf_ptr, uint8_t* tx_buf_ptr, uint32_t size);

    // *************************************************************************
    // ***   Public: Write   ***************************************************
    // *************************************************************************
    virtual Result Write(uint8_t* tx_buf_ptr, uint32_t tx_size);

    // *************************************************************************
    // ***   Public: Read   ****************************************************
    // *************************************************************************
    virtual Result Read(uint8_t* rx_buf_ptr, uint32_t rx_size);

    // *************************************************************************
    // ***   Public: TransferAsync   *******************************************
    // *************************************************************************
    virtual Result TransferAsync(uint8_t* rx_buf_ptr, uint8_t* tx_buf_ptr, uint32_t size);

    // *************************************************************************
    // ***   Public: WriteAsync   **********************************************
    // *************************************************************************
    virtual Result WriteAsync(uint8_t* tx_buf_ptr, uint32_t tx_size);

    // *************************************************************************
    // ***   Public: ReadAsync   ***********************************************
    // *************************************************************************
    virtual Result ReadAsync(uint8_t* rx_buf_ptr, uint32_t rx_size);

    // *************************************************************************
    // ***   Public: Check SPI transfer status   *******************************
    // *************************************************************************
    virtual bool IsTransferComplete(void);

    // *************************************************************************
    // ***   Public: Abort   ***************************************************
    // *************************************************************************
    virtual Result Abort(void);

    // *************************************************************************
    // ***   Public: SetSpeed   ************************************************
    // *************************************************************************
    virtual Result SetSpeed(uint32_t clock_rate);

    // *************************************************************************
    // ***   Public: GetSpeed   ************************************************
    // *************************************************************************
    virtual Result GetSpeed(uint32_t& clock_rate);

  private:
    // Reference to the SPI handle
    SPI_HandleTypeDef& hspi;

    // *************************************************************************
    // ***   Private: GetToDataSizeBytes   *************************************
    // *************************************************************************
    uint32_t GetToDataSizeBytes();

    // *************************************************************************
    // ***   Private: ConvertResult   ******************************************
    // *************************************************************************
    Result ConvertResult(HAL_StatusTypeDef hal_result);

    // *************************************************************************
    // ***   Private: Constructors and assign operator - prevent copying   *****
    // *************************************************************************
    StHalSpi();
    StHalSpi(const StHalSpi&);
    StHalSpi& operator=(const StHalSpi);
};

#endif
